  • Mission

    To promote whole person wellness with vulnerable individuals in Calhoun County through recovery-oriented support services, including a drop-in resource center and peer support services. We provide a safe, mutually-supportive environment to improve and cultivate a productive quality of life by fostering hope, community inclusion, and independence.

    About Us

    The SHARE Center was founded in 1986 and is the only drop-in day center in Calhoun County, serving individuals living with homelessness, mental illness, substance use disorders, and other challenging issues. The SHARE Center coordinates with other local agencies to provide daily meals, case management, peer support, recovery groups, veteran services, and other resources most needed by our consumers.
